General Summary of Position
The Pharmacy Technician I assists the Pharmacist in preparing and distributing medications to patients. The Pharmacy Technician performs designated technical functions to facilitate pharmacy operations.
Primary Duties and Responsibilities
- Consistently fulfills all the responsibilities of the Pharmacy Material Handler.
- Under the supervision of the licensed Pharmacist prepares oral and topical medications for dispensing to patients including the selection labeling and packaging of appropriate pharmaceuticals and filling of medication carts.
- Assists patients nurses physicians and others with medication order requests and pharmacy related needs.
- Monitors stock inventory levels and medication expiration dates for pharmacy areas and replenishes medications as needed. Conducts monthly/periodic inspections of patient care/department areas.
- Pulls fills and replaces medications in the automated medication dispensing machines and transports to appropriate nursing unit(s). Services the Pyxis machines as needed
- Performs hourly or more frequent deliveries and retrieves medications including narcotics and pharmacy supplies to/from patient care and satellite pharmacy areas based on patient care needs.
- Repackages individual unit-of-use packaging when not otherwise available.
- Loads and unloads the TUG and restocks medications in the store room as needed. Empties the TUG and resends as needed. Logs all TUG related issues.
- Completes and maintains relevant controlled substance inventory logs/records.
- Exchanges medication carts and the IV batch and recycles all in-date medications. Disposes of all expired medications based on departmental policy.
- Maintains clean and orderly workstations.
